BRAZIL (t) 3255.05 Radiodifusora 6 de Agosto, Dec 29, 1017-1030, Portuguese talks and ballads, announcer with tentative "...Radio Xapuri..." ID at 1022, fair signal until 1030 fade out. (Mohrmann-VT) BRAZIL 4894.93 Radio Baré, Dec 31, 0957, Portuguese announcements, 0959 "...Radio Baré..." ID, 1000 apparent full ID, into ballad, Fairly strong signal but deep fades. (Mohrmann-VT) ECUADOR? 2299.84 Unidentified, Dec 29, 1003-1055, very weak Andean flute and drum intrumentals, Malm reported La Voz de Riobamba (2x1150) in March 2003 on 2299.81. and recently their 3rd harmonic on 3449.76. (Mohrmann-VT) PERU (t) 4260.40 Radio Ilucan, (3x1420) Jan 02, 1041-1105, as reported by Wilkner and Bolland down in Florida, Andean vocals, lots of announcements (probably ads) but no ID heard, // weaker 2840.27 but nothing heard on 5677, poor signal.
